2021 Doha MotoGP, Qatar - Free Practice (3) Results
![Fabio Quartararo dust on track, Doha MotoGP, 3 April 2021](https://cdn.crash.net/image_importer/MotoGP/2772650.0008.jpg?width=400)
Quartararo leads a 'slow' Free Practice 3 at a windy and dusty Doha MotoGP.
The top 10 riders after FP3 (combined times) receive direct access to the second and final part of qualifying, but the strong winds and dust - combined with the afternoon heat - meant some riders stayed in the pits (including Friday leader Miller) and nobody improved on yesterday's lap times.
That means the likes of reigning world champion Mir, Rossi and Honda's Espargaro will be among those battling it out in Qualifying 1.
The Doha Grand Prix is the second of two back-to-back opening rounds held at Losail in Qatar.
Bradl is again replacing the injured Marc Marquez, who is missing both Qatar rounds.
